Proposal

Amendments to the development approved under planning permission 25/01111/FULL6 (demolition of rear conservatory and chimney; erection of a one/two-storey rear extension; loft conversion including rear roof dormer, two front rooflights, one side rooflight and elevational alterations) to alter the depth of the single storey rear extension and elevational alterations, extend the depth of the existing raised terrace and install a new boundary fence.

As published by the council, reference 26/01141/HPA

What happens while it is decided

This application is with Bromley for determination, against a statutory target of eight weeks. Over the last year Bromley decided householder applications in a median of 58 days. More in our guide to how long planning decisions take.

About householder applications

Householder applications cover work to an existing house and its garden, such as extensions, lofts and outbuildings, and cannot create a separate dwelling or change what the building is used for. More in our guide to planning application types.
